Workshop Announcement: ---------------------------------------------------------------- The Kardar-Parisi-Zhang equation and universality class ---------------------------------------------------------------- October 24 to October 28, 2011 American Institute of Mathematics Research Conference Center Palo Alto, California http://aimath.org/ARCC/workshops/kpzequation.html ------------ Description: ------------ This workshop, sponsored by AIM and the NSF, will be devoted to the study of the the Kardar-Parisi-Zhang equation and universality class. The workshop is organized by Ivan Corwin and Jeremy Quastel. Applications are open to all, and we especially encourage women, underrepresented minorities, junior mathematicians, and researchers from primarily undergraduate institutions to apply. -------------------------------- AIM Research Conference Center: -------------------------------- The American Institute of Mathematics (AIM) hosts focused workshops in all areas of the mathematical sciences. AIM focused workshops are distinguished by their emphasis on a specific mathematical goal, such as making progress on a significant unsolved problem, understanding the proof of an important new result, or investigating the convergence between two distinct areas of mathematics.
